Gustave Loiseau

Gustave Loiseau (3 October 1865, Paris – 10 October 1935, Paris) was a French Post-Impressionist painter, remembered above all for his landscapes and scenes of Paris streets. 〔 ("Loiseau Gustave" ), ''Expertisez magazine''. Retrieved 13 May 2012.〕
==Early life==

Brought up in Paris and Pontoise by parents who owned a butchers shop, Loiseau served an apprenticeship with a decorator who was a friend of the family. In 1887, when a legacy from his grandmother allowed him to concentrate on painting, he enrolled at the École des arts décoratifs where he studied life-drawing. However, a year later he left the school after an argument with his teacher.〔("Gustave Loiseau (1865 - Paris - 1935 - Paris)" ), ''Galeries Hurtebize''. Retrieved 15 May 2012.〕
